"Dream - Indonesian society is still recorded as the largest group of tourists who choose Singapore as a vacation destination. The number of Indonesian tourist visits is even almost twice as much as China, which is in second place."

"A total of 2.3 million Indonesian tourists visited Singapore in 2023. This number is the highest compared to tourists from other countries, so the majority last year was from Indonesia," said Terrence Voon during a press conference and Iftar together in Central Jakarta on Tuesday, March 26, 2024, yesterday."
According to Terrence, the tourism sector in Singapore is starting to move towards recovery after seeing the number of foreign tourists arriving in Singapore reaching 13.6 million in 2023. Meanwhile, regarding the large number of Indonesian tourists visiting Singapore, Terrence revealed that most Indonesians come to attend various events held in the country. One of them is Taylor Swift's concert, which is watched by many Indonesians.
"We see that Singapore remains an attractive destination for tourism and business. Indonesia is a major and important market for Singapore, and we will continue to nurture and strengthen partnerships with industry stakeholders to drive tourism growth," he continued. Terrence also added that most tourists from Indonesia who vacation in Singapore come from three major cities in Indonesia. Those three cities are Jakarta, Surabaya, and the Riau Islands, which are relatively close to Singapore."

Indriati Permanasari, as the Manager of Indonesia International Group STB, said that several tourist destinations in Singapore have indeed become world-renowned, including Jewel Changi, Marina Bay Sands, Garden by The Bay, Universal Studio Singapore, Genting Dream Destination Cruises, Trifecta, SEA Oceanarium, Bird Paradise, and so on. However, among the many tourist destinations, according to Indriati, Jewel Changi and shopping tourism are the most favored by Indonesian citizens.
"Many are curious about the waterfall at Changi Airport's Jewel Changi, it feels like bathing when you're in this attraction. As for shopping, the Orchard area is still a favorite among tourists, including those from Indonesia," said Indriati.
He added, a number of new rides and events are being prepared in the near future and early next year. One of them is the Harry Potter: A Forbidden Forest Experience on Sentosa Island. This ride, intended for Harry Potter fans, has just opened last February.
Not only rides, there is Singapore Sidecars that you can visit to experience a different sensation of exploring various areas in Singapore. Sidecar is a fleet that is modified with additions such as a place attached to the side of a vespa and motorbike.
Additional space makes passengers feel comfortable because of the wider seating. So drivers or riders from Singapore Sidecars can take you around places in Singapore that you want to pass by and enjoy.
Familiar with your favorite cartoon characters? You can directly capture or take photos that catch attention at Universal Studios Singapore (USS).
There is also a new attraction that catches the attention of Minion fans from Despicable Me at USS. This popular yellow fictional character will replace the Madagascar zone at USS. When in Singapore, don't miss out on a number of events that are held, one of which is the Geylang Serai Bazaar Raya, which is an annual event. You can also explore the bustling market adorned with colorful stalls offering various Malay and Muslim traditional foods, clothing, decorations, and much more, which will take place from March 8th to April 9th, 2024.
